    Helping your student at home

    Please keep in mind that this time is not about you knowing each subject and helping the student to do their work, this time is about you showing that you are interested in their education, helping your students get organized, providing a quiet place for the students to do their work, monitoring the students work to make sure is completed and praising their efforts.

    Here are some tips to get you started:

    • Talk with your student, let the student know that education is important and that the school work should be done
    • Set a time for your students to complete assignments, have the student participate in the creation of the schedule and follow-up on that every day. It is helpful to write the schedule and posted at home in a visible place at home where everyone can see it.
    • Remove all distractions, turn off the TV, and other devices that might distract the student during study time.

     

    Student’s assignments overview

    Your student will have assignments to complete daily and these assignments are to turn in for evaluation/feedback. In a language class we read, write, listen and speak therefore we will be covering all of these areas.

    The following are your weekly work instructions and all work must be completed in Spanish: 

    Writing: Your student must keep a journal and have an entry for every day that students are not at school (half to one page per day (write about your day, what did you do, how do you feel, people, food...etc)

    Reading: The students must select three readings per week and complete the activities for each reading and/or choice board . Readings  are posted under classwork/materials in our google classroom.

    Listening: Listen to two songs in Spanish per week and write key vocabulary and the main idea per song in Spanish. I will also add listening activities to google forms to complete.

    Speaking: If your student has the opportunity to speak Spanish please have them practice the language :) I will be posting flipgrids tasks so I can see your student speaking Spanish

    Vocabulary practice: Students will use their vocabulary and activities from the choice board, graphic organizer and BOOM cards to practice vocabulary. Students can also access my wiki to practice vocabulary using quizlet.
